W. P. Carey Inc. Raises $400 Million Through Senior Notes Auction

W. P. Carey Inc. Secures $400 Million in Senior Unsecured Notes
W. P. Carey Inc. (NYSE: WPC), has recently announced the successful pricing of an underwritten public offering of $400 million in aggregate principal amount of 4.650% Senior Notes due 2030. These notes were priced at 99.088% of the principal amount, reflecting the company’s robust position in the capital markets.
Understanding the Terms of the Notes
Interest on these Senior Notes will be disbursed semi-annually on January 15 and July 15, starting from January 15, 2026. This offering is anticipated to settle shortly, subject to standard closing conditions.
Purpose of the Fundraising
The net proceeds from this offering will primarily be utilized to repay existing debt, including a portion of the $2.0 billion unsecured revolving credit facility. Additionally, these funds will support various other general corporate objectives, showcasing W. P. Carey Inc.'s commitment to financial prudence and strategic growth.
Management of the Offering
Noteworthy financial institutions such as Wells Fargo Securities, LLC, BofA Securities, Inc., Scotia Capital (USA) Inc., and Mizuho Securities USA LLC served as the joint book-running managers for this significant offering. Long-term Stability in Real Estate
W. P. Carey Inc. operates as an internally-managed diversified real estate investment trust (REIT). The company is a leader in owning and managing commercial real estate properties that are primarily net-leased to companies. Its diverse portfolio includes vital single-tenant properties integral to its tenants' operations, especially in industrial and retail sectors.
